About

Tania Mahler is a scholar working on Surgery, Gastroenterology and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Tania Mahler has authored 21 papers receiving a total of 680 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 12 papers in Surgery, 10 papers in Gastroenterology and 4 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ine. Recurrent topics in Tania Mahler’s work include Gastroesophageal reflux and treatments (8 papers), Esophageal and GI Pathology (3 papers) and Pancreatic Islet Dysfunction and Regeneration (3 papers). Tania Mahler is often cited by papers focused on Gastroesophageal reflux and treatments (8 papers), Esophageal and GI Pathology (3 papers) and Pancreatic Islet Dysfunction and Regeneration (3 papers). Tania Mahler collaborates with scholars based in Belgium, United States and Vietnam. Tania Mahler's co-authors include R Kiekens, Daniël Pipeleers, Saı̈d Hachimi-Idrissi, M. Van De Winkel, F. Schuit, Pieter In 'T Veld, Ann Casteels, Bruno Hauser, Yvan Vandenplas and Yvan Vandenplas and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Clinical Investigation, Diabetes and CHEST Journal.
